However, in the video, you can see the pictures from Postman&#8217;s Park.  This particular park is one of my favorite places in the city.  It is a small green space hidden between some buildings behind St Paul&#8217;s Cathedral.  It is a peaceful but also somewhat sad place.  The park is a memorial to those who have died while saving the lives of other people.  Many of them are children that are memorialized through small but tasteful plaques.
